原创 CSS3彈性佈局

<style>         /*             ------------------             -  - -  - -  - - -             -  - -  - -  - - -        

原创 bash shell 4.2 自定義rm別名,以避免誤刪重要文件,而無法找回的事故

這裏只介紹當前用戶全局別名設置,不討論只在用戶當前終端作用的別名設置。     首先在任意目錄下新建一個腳本文件,建議在當前用戶home目錄下建立一個腳本文件,也就是 cd ~ 的目錄下面。     具體步驟如下:     創建safer

原创 多線程知識總結

多線程創建線程的兩種方式1.繼承Thread,覆蓋父類Run方法2.實現Runable接口,重寫Run方法多線程機制並沒有提高程序的運行效率,只是因爲開啓了多個線程,佔用了服務器更多的帶寬。定時器Timer TimerTasknew Ti

原创 solr服務的安裝與配置

1.到Apach官方下載對應的tgz包。2.解壓tgz包,獲取/example/lib/ext目錄下的所有jar包,添加到自定義solr工程的WEB-INF/lib包下。3.創建一個solrhome目錄(管理solr服務的),可以參考/e

原创 模板模式抽取Struts2模型驅動及分頁重複代碼,簡化開發

public abstract class BaseAction<T> extends ActionSupport implementsModelDriven<T> {// 模型驅動protected T

原创 IE禁用Cookie後的解決方案

IE禁用Cookie後,會導致服務端Session無法回寫JSESSIONID到瀏覽器。當瀏覽器再次訪問時,Session中也就不會有記錄。但服務端可以在瀏覽器端禁用Cookie後,通過response對象在返回的URL中將編碼後的Coo

原创 EasyUi的DataGrid單元格編輯

<script type="text/javascript"> $(function() { // 頁面加載後,對datagrid 進行設置 $("#grid").datagrid({ url: "datagrid_data.json"

原创 常用排序算法總結

排序算法  冒泡 插入 歸併 穩定性好1.冒泡排序算法:通過嵌套for循環,將相鄰的數進行兩兩比較。如果後面的數大就不變,如果後面的數小,就將前面的數與後面的數交換位置。2.選擇排序算法:首先從序列中獲取最小的那個數值,將該數值放在首位,